"Embassies Evacuate Staff and Bolster Security Amid Haiti's Escalating Gang Violence"

The US, German, and EU embassies have initiated evacuations of their staff from Haiti as gang violence in Port-au-Prince escalates, with the US military conducting an operation to airlift non-essential personnel and bolster embassy security. The German and European Union missions have also evacuated diplomatic staff, including their ambassadors, due to the heightened insecurity. The decision to leave was motivated by the escalating violence and the escape of thousands of prisoners, prompting concerns about potential gang attacks on well-to-do areas. The chaos has forced tens of thousands to flee their homes, affecting aid distribution and causing the country's healthcare system to near collapse. Meanwhile, Haitian gang leader Jimmy Cherizier has threatened civil war if Prime Minister Ariel Henry does not step down, as CARICOM plans to hold a meeting on Haiti's situation.
